SPONSORSHIP AGREEMENT WITH THE LANDING FOR RENTON'S
FABULOUS 4T" OF JULY 2017
THIS AGREEMENT is made as of the 6�h day of June, 2017, between the CITY OF
RENTON, a municipal corporation of the State of Washington, hereinafter referred to as
"CITY," and JSH PROPERTIES ON BEHALF OF CPT THE LANDING LLC, DBA"THE
LANDING," hereinafter referred to as "SPONSOR," to provide financial sponsor support of
Renton's Fabulous 4t'' of Julv for 2017, hereinafter referred to as "EVENT."
The CITY and SPONSOR agree as set forth below:
1. Event Date(s) and Location: EVENT is July 4, 2017. EVENT will be held at Gene
Coulon Memorial Beach Park.
2. Recognition and Benefits: SPONSOR will be featured as the Event Co-Sponsor
of EVEN7. SPONSOR's name and/or logo will be included in print promotions and
on the CITY's website, as set forth in Attachment A, "Sponsor Recognition &
Benefits," which is attached and incorporated herein. Sponsorship will be promoted
as "Event Co-Sponsored by The Landing." Other benefits to SPONSOR are as also
set forth in Attachment A.
3. Sponsor's Responsibilities: In exchange for the recognition and benefits under
� this AGREEMENT, SPONSOR shall pay the sum of$7,500.00 (seven thousand five
hundred dollars) to the CITY. Payment in full shall be made no later than June 30,
2017, to the CITY. SPONSOR shall provide its logo to the CITY for event marketing
purposes.
4. Term: This AGREEMENT shali commence on the date above-written and shall
continue until July 5, 2017.
5. Cancellation Policy: The CITY has the right to cancel EVENT due to inclement
weather or for any other reason. The CITY will notify SPONSOR immediately
following the decision to cancel EVENT. Furthermore, the City will credit SPONSOR
with sponsorship opportunities at a future event worth the estimated value of the lost

Attachment A
Sponsor Recognition & Benefits
a) Sponsor's Name/Logo featured in City of Renton produced and paid event promotions and
marketing, including flyers, event poster, and print ad.
b) Feature information in the City's Parks & Recreation Summer Guide (40,000 produced).
c) Newsprint press releases leading up to event.
d) Summer community event flyer and cross promotion pieces.
e) Featured spotlight on the City website� www.rentonwa.gov(historically, over 200,000
weekly page views).
fl Social media inclusions on City of Renton Facebook and Nextdoor.
g) Link(s)to Sponsor website from City's 4th of July event pages.
h) Event information featured on the electronic reader board at the Renton Community Center
along Maple Valley Highway.
i) Renton Chamber of Commerce Newsletter event flyer insert.
j) Listing on the Renton Chamber of Commerce Community Events webpage.
k) City to provide 10x10 or 10x20 space for Sponsor display booth during event(if requested).
I) Sponsor to distribute marketing materials �elated to own organization/services from within
Sponsor display booth during event. If preferred, Sponsor can provide marketing materials
which will be distributed from the City of Renton Event Information Booth.
